Roy experiences heavy rainfall during the winter months due to atmospheric river events, increasing the risk of water intrusion. The region's proximity to hills also leads to runoff and potential flooding in lower-lying areas.

Local mold risk: Roy's humid climate creates an ideal environment for mold growth after water damage. High humidity levels can significantly increase the risk of mold spreading within 24-48 hours if not addressed promptly.
